July 28th 2015

28/7/2015

 
Information uploaded on July 28th 2015 at 13:45
Stagecoach Cumbria & North Lancashire has transferred Volvo Olympians 16640 and 16642 to the Reserve Fleet, which removes the type from the main operational fleet at Kendal. Dart 34718 is confirmed as transferring from Carlisle to Kendal. It has been replaced at Carlisle by E200 37121 from the Reserve Fleet. Reserve Fleet Volvo Olympians 16652 and 16662 are now awaiting disposal, whilst MAN/ALX300s 22728 and 22730 along with Volvo B10M coach 52268 have been sold and are no longer part of this fleet.
East Yorkshire Motor Services reports that Volvo Olympians 630, 631 and 632 have been sold.
